English > eccentric: 4 senses > adjective 1
Meaningconspicuously or grossly unconventional or unusual.
Example "famed for his eccentric spelling"
Synonymsbizarre, freakish, freaky, flaky, flakey, gonzo, off-the-wall, outlandish, outre
Broaderunconventionalnot conventional or conformist

English > eccentric: 4 senses > adjective 2
Meaningnot having a common center; not concentric.
Example"eccentric circles"
Synonymnonconcentric
Narroweracentricnot centered or having no center
off-center, off-centeredsituated away from the center or axis
Oppositeconcentric, concentrical, homocentricHaving a common center
